For these skins to work on the twin-seater FF-18 you must have the latest (2.1 And Beyond) Playable Cut Aircraft mod installed.
In theory, these skins should also work on the normal FE-18. However, I have not tested them, and the .PNG files would need to be renamed.

Included are 3 .PNG skins.
-Dark Grey
-The same Dark Grey skin, with Gold Accents and Stripes
-Winter Camo
To install one or all of the skins, find the Project Wingman installation location on your computer (browse local files on Steam). Once there, open the Project Wingman Folder. Create a folder called Mods in the Project Wingman Folder. And then create a file called Skins. Finally, drag and drop any .PNG skins you want and they should (fingers crossed) show up in the game.
